Sourcing guidance for Cotton Baby Sleep Suit

What are the key material standards for high-quality cotton baby sleep suits?

Prioritize 100% combed cotton or organic cotton to ensure breathability and skin-friendliness. Look for fabrics with a GSM (Grams per Square Meter) of 160-200 for year-round comfort. It is critical to verify OEKO-TEX® Standard 100 or G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) certifications to ensure the absence of harmful chemicals and dyes.

What safety features and compliance standards must be met for international markets?

For the US market, products must comply with CPSC (Consumer Product Safety Commission) regulations, specifically 16 CFR Part 1610 for flammability and CPSIA for lead and phthalate content. In the EU, adhere to EN 14878. Ensure all fasteners like snaps and zippers pass pull-test requirements (typically 90N for 10 seconds) to prevent choking hazards.

What functional design elements should B2B buyers look for to increase marketability?

Focus on designs that offer two-way zippers for easy diaper changes and zipper guards to protect the baby's chin. For newborns, integrated scratch mittens and fold-over footies add significant value. Ensure flat-lock stitching is used to prevent skin irritation and that labels are tagless or printed directly on the fabric.

How can buyers verify the durability and shrinkage of cotton sleep suits?

Request third-party lab reports focusing on dimensional stability (shrinkage), which should not exceed +/- 5% after multiple washes. Also, check for colorfastness to saliva and perspiration (Grade 4 or higher) to ensure the garment maintains its appearance and safety during use.

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Baby Apparel

How can I mitigate quality risks when sourcing from overseas suppliers?

Always request a pre-production sample (PPS) for approval before mass production begins. Utilize third-party inspection services (like V-Trust or QIMA) to conduct a During Production Check (DUPRO) and a Final Random Inspection (FRI). On platforms like Made-in-China.com, prioritize Audited Suppliers who have undergone comprehensive on-site verification.

What are the best strategies for negotiating with baby clothing manufacturers?

Negotiate based on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the unit price. Discuss tiered pricing where the unit cost drops as volume increases (e.g., 500, 1000, 5000 units). Ask for a spare parts allowance (1-2%) for snaps or zippers and clarify that the defect rate must be below 1.5% for the batch to be accepted.

What logistics and customs considerations are specific to textile imports?

Ensure the supplier provides an accurate HS Code (typically 6111.20 for cotton baby garments) to avoid customs delays and incorrect duty applications. Be aware of Country of Origin (COO) labeling requirements, which must be permanently sewn into the garment. For shipping to the US or Europe, consider vacuum packaging to reduce volume and save on freight costs.

How do I ensure transaction security during the purchasing process?

Use Secured Payment services provided by reputable B2B platforms like Made-in-China.com to ensure funds are only released after shipping confirmation. Avoid direct wire transfers to private accounts; always pay to the company's registered corporate account as verified in their business license.
